Motorola’s popular Q smartphone will be available on AT&T’s wireless network beginning Friday. The e-mail-friendly device will tout W-CDMA high-speed downlink packet access technology, giving it download speeds of up to 3.6Mbps, according to a Motorola official. (TWICE 11/1)

Motorola has completed its joint-development agreement with Phiar, which the company will reportedly use in several upcoming products, including next-generation 60-GHz mobile wireless, point-to-point networks, wireless HDMI and imaging technologies. “By working together with Phiar, we were able to validate the performance of metal-insulator diodes in our receivers,” Vida Ilderem, vice president of physical and digital realization research for Motorola Labs, said. (EDN/Electronic News 10/31)
